Welcome and congrats on your engagement

The number one piece of advice I can give you is to remember that it's you and your fiance's wedding. Everyone around you is going to want to give input on your day, but don't feel obligated to please everyone. That will just lead to regret and wishes after the fact that you had done it your way.

The only other thing I think is a for sure idea is find a good wedding website with a check list. This one is good for venting and getting opinions, but I like weddingwire's checklist.

So you are getting married in April of next year? That will give you a lot of time for planning. One thing I learned so far is compromise. My fiance and I both have different ideas of what we want for our wedding but we keep trying to find our middle ground so its perfect for both of us. When one of you gets demanding nobody wins.
Another tip I would give you is try to keep it fun and RELAX!!! Too many people stress out more than they need to. Try not to become a bridezilla and just go with the flow.
